The U.S. House Pressure’s robotic area airplane X-37B returned to Earth has returned to Earth after spending greater than 434 days in orbit on a labeled mission.

This was the seventh mission for the X-37B area airplane, formally designated X-37B Orbital Take a look at Automobile-7 (OTV-7), which landed at Vandenberg House Pressure Base in California, at the moment (March 7). Landing occurred at 2:22 a.m. EST (0722 GMT).

In the course of the mission, the Boeing-built X-37B carried out a novel “aerobraking maneuver” that demonstrated its sturdy maneuver functionality. Within the aerobraking maneuver, X-37B used the drag attributable to Earth’s ambiance to alter its orbit extra effectively.

“Mission 7 broke new floor by showcasing the X-37B’s potential to flexibly accomplish its check and experimentation goals throughout orbital regimes,” Chief of House Operations Probability Saltzman stated in a statement from Space Force. “The profitable execution of the aerobraking maneuver underscores the U.S. House Pressure’s dedication to pushing the bounds of novel area operations in a secure and accountable method.”

It wasn’t simply the flexibleness of X-37B within the air that was beneath scrutiny throughout this mission.

This was the primary time that the area airplane had launched atop a SpaceX Falcon Heavy rocket to a extremely elliptical (flattened) orbit. From there, the airplane carried out what House Pressure describes as “area area consciousness expertise experiments that intention to enhance america House Pressure’s data of the area atmosphere.” SpaceX launched the X-37B OTV-7 mission on Dec. 28, 2023.

The aerobraking maneuver was used to take X-37B from the extremely elliptical orbit to a low Earth orbit whereas conserving gasoline. After conducting additional experiments, the airplane deorbited and returned to Earth.

“Mission 7’s operation in a brand new orbital regime, its novel aerobraking maneuver, and its testing of area area consciousness experiments have written an thrilling new chapter within the X-37B program,” X-37B Program Director Blaine Stewart stated. “Thought of collectively, they mark a major milestone within the ongoing growth of the U.S. House Pressure’s dynamic mission functionality.”

Regardless of it is lengthy 434-day mission, the X-37B’s OTV-7 flight wasn’t the longest flight for the robotic area airplane. That file was set in the course of the OTV-6 mission, which spent 908 days in orbit between Could 2020 and November 2022. The truth is, each X-37B flight since 2011 has spent an extended time in area than OTV-7, with solely the primary flight  — the 224-day OTV-1 mission  — spending much less time in orbit.

The U.S. House Pressure at the moment has two X-37B area planes to fly these autonomous area missions.
